【问题标题】:What kind of iPhone / iPod Touch do I need to test my app?我需要什么样的 iPhone / iPod Touch 来测试我的应用程序?
【发布时间】:2011-03-07 22:42:33
【问题描述】:

我为 iPhone 编写了一个相当基本的应用程序,我想在至少一台设备上对其进行测试,然后将其推向市场。

我不需要数据计划,因此我正在考虑购买 iPod touch,但我知道它没有相机、视频和指南针。虽然我当前的应用程序不需要这些,但我可能会在未来的应用程序中使用这些,但那里没有任何确定性。

我对购买 iPhone(无论是旧的还是新的)的担忧是,我相信除非我越狱,否则我将无法在没有 SIM 卡的情况下使用它。我不想参与越狱,因为我不清楚我将如何努力在设备上测试应用程序和/或将应用程序放到应用程序商店。

如果我得到一部新 iPhone,我将不得不立即取消合同,我同样担心没有 SIM 卡。

我会对人们在这个问题上的体验感兴趣,例如开始使用 iPhone 应用程序并且没有 iPhone,就是有这个问题。

【问题讨论】:

    标签: iphone marketplace


    【解决方案1】:

    最新的 iPod Touch 有摄像头:http://www.apple.com/ipodtouch/

    您应该能够测试几乎所有需要在 iPod Touch 上测试的东西。

    此外,如果您想支持旧设备,最好在 eBay 或其他地方购买旧的旧 iPod Touch,这样您就可以在非 Retina 显示器上进行测试。

    【讨论】:

    • 我决定使用 touch 是因为 1) 我有一个旧的 ipod,可以以 10% 的折扣换购 2) 我不需要手机 3) 它比手机轻 4 ) 我不必担心 sim 卡(虽然我认为没问题)和 5) 我可以马上开始使用它
    【解决方案2】:

    我在没有 iPhone 的情况下进行开发,但更喜欢使用设备进行开发,因为您可以不时测试您的代码。 iPod Touch 4 确实有摄像头。无论如何,我认为 iPhone 仍然能够在没有 SIM 卡的情况下正常运行,只是您无法拨打电话。否则,获得 iPad 并没有那么糟糕,因为您可以在 iPad 上运行 iPad 和 iPhone 应用程序。

    【讨论】:

      【解决方案3】:

      您可能希望获得运行最旧版本的 iOS 的最旧最慢的设备型号,您希望您的应用在该版本上兼容。这也可能是一种在设备上进行测试的低成本方式。如果您的应用在商业上取得成功,您将有能力购买更多更新的测试设备,但旧设备可能是最有价值的应用测试设备。

      【讨论】:

        【解决方案4】:

        我一直在使用我的旧 iPhone 3G 进行开发,主要是因为它可以让我看到我的代码是如何在最慢的设备之一上运行的。

        该手机目前尚未与 AT&T 签约,但仍可正常用于开发。对于数据访问,wifi 可以在没有运营商帐户的情况下正常工作。它还有摄像头和(基本)GPS/地图。

        我可能会以相对便宜的价格从拍卖网站上买一部二手 iPhone 3G。

        【讨论】:

          猜你喜欢
          • 2010-10-10
          • 2010-10-12
          • 1970-01-01
          • 2014-02-04
          • 1970-01-01
          • 1970-01-01
          • 1970-01-01
          • 1970-01-01
          • 1970-01-01
          相关资源
          最近更新 更多